Subject: Resolution to approve Amendment No. 2 to the Grant Agreement with Action Community Center, Inc.
for pre -arranged transportation services.
Purpose of Item:
To request approval of the attached resolution, by a four -fifths (4/5ths) affirmative vote, ratifying, approving and
confirming the City Manager's finding that it is in the best interest of the City of Miami (City) to waive competitive
sealed bidding procedures provided in the Code of the City of Miami, Florida, as amended (City Code), pursuant to
Sections 18-85(a) and 18-90; authorizing an increase, in an amount not to exceed $53,334 to the Grant Agreement
(Agreement) between the City and Action Community Center, Inc. (Action), for pre -arranged transportation services
for low to moderate income elderly and/or disabled Miami residents. This Resolution further authorizes an extension of
Action's Agreement from December 31, 2011 to February 29, 2012 and authorizes the City Manager to execute
Amendment No. 2, for said purposes. Funds are to be allocated from the City's share of the Transit Surtax.
Background Information:
The Capital Improvements Program (CIP) and the Office of Transportation procured through the Purchasing
Department a Request for Proposals (RFP) No. 274276,1 on June 24, 2011 to procure a qualified and experienced
company to operate an On -Demand Transportation Service for the City of Miami. The City received a formal Bid
Protest of Award on August 29, 2011 and a stay of procurement was invoked per Section 18-104(d) of the City Code.
The City Manager's Bid Protest recommendation is being presented to the City Commission concurrently for approval.
Should the City Commission deny the protest and authorize award of a contract, a two (2) month extension to Action's
Agreement is necessary allowing for a transitional period.
